Report Overview:

This NelsonHall assessment analyzes Infosys’ offerings and capabilities in wealth and asset management services. Infosys is one of a number of wealth and asset management services companies analyzed in NelsonHall’s comprehensive industry analysis programs.

Key Findings & Highlights:

Infosys entered the wealth and asset (W&A) BPS business in 2004 with a U.S. headquartered global custodian. The first step in the relationship involved supporting the following business processes:

  • Fund administration reconciliation services
  • Data management.

Over time the relationship grew, including:

  • Year 2: trade management, corporate actions and reconciliation analysis
  • Year 3: portfolio analysis, income collection, tax collections, reorganizations, and accounts payable
  • Year 4: at this point the client undertook a change in platform, and Infosys began to provide support for non-U.S. countries; this included billing, portfolio compliance, and portfolio review.

Over time, Infosys added more W&A BPS services for the above mentioned global custodian, as well as adding new W&A BPS clients.

Infosys W&A BPS delivers services from six delivery centers, to support clients around the globe:

  • Gurgaon
  • Pune
  • Bangalore
  • Czech Republic
  • Salt Lake City
  • Dublin.

Infosys’ primary targets for W&A BPS are:

  • Wealth managers headquartered in the U.S., U.K., and Canada
  • Tier 1 asset managers based in the U.S.
  • Global custodians.
